I have three SXs (two PJs and one J) and they're golden. Perfect. I'm not afraid of these cheap basses. In fact I bought the first SX thinking it would be a good bass to learn to modify. All I did was put flats on it. On the second one, a PJ, I changed out the pickups to some Geezers, isolated the cavity, and put some black knobs on it. The J is stock and it's my go-to.
I want a Glarry Jazz to see if it's just as good only 40 cheaper than what I paid for the SXs. I'm hooked! Plus I'd give one to a friend in a heartbeat. They're great players and no "golden handcuffs" feeling you get from an expensive bass. Sure, I want a Geddy Lee Jazz but I just can't justify it with these options.
